Ingredients:
â
200 g sugar
â
4 large eggs
â
200 g wheat flour
â
200 g butter (at room temperature)
â
1 sachet of baking powder
â
1 pinch of salt
â
2 tablespoons of unsweetened cocoa powder
â
1 teaspoon of vanilla extract
â
60 ml of milk

Instructions:
1ïžâŁ Preheat and prepare the mold:
⹠Heat the oven to 180°C (350°F).
âą Grease and flour a mold or line it with baking paper.
2ïžâŁ Prepare the base dough:
âą Beat the butter with the sugar until you get a creamy and fluffy texture.
âą Add the eggs one by one, beating well after each addition.
3ïžâŁ Add the dry ingredients:
âą Sift the flour, baking powder and salt.
âą Add little by little to the previous mixture, alternating with the milk and vanilla.
4ïžâŁ Divide the dough:
âą Separate the mixture into two equal parts.
âą To one of them, add the sifted cocoa powder and mix until well combined.
5ïžâŁ Create the marbled effect:
âą Pour alternately spoonfuls of the vanilla and chocolate mixture into the mold.
âą Using a knife or skewer, make gentle spiral movements to achieve the marbled effect.
6ïžâŁ Bake:
âą Bake for 35-45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
7ïžâŁ Cool and enjoy:
âą Let c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then unmold onto a wire rack.
